How and when you're charged

When Layout charges you, your spending limits, and how totals are set.

Layout only charges you for orders you confirm. Here's how it works.

You confirm every order

Before any order goes through, Layout shows you the full total and waits for your yes. No confirm, no charge.

Your spending limits

You've got two safeguards on every order:

  • Daily limit. $50 by default. You can set it anywhere from $10 to $150 in your settings.

  • Spending pool. You approve up to $150 at a time in a single step. Your orders draw from it, and once it runs out, Layout asks you to approve a new one.

Both limits have to allow an order for it to go through.

How your total is set

Layout uses the restaurant's current prices when it builds your order, so your total reflects real items, taxes, and fees at that moment. You'll always see the total in the preview before you confirm.

Layout's ordering fee

On the free plan, Layout adds a small ordering fee on orders placed through your assistant. With Layout One, that fee is waived on unlimited orders. See What Layout One includes.

Once you confirm

Confirmed orders go straight to the restaurant and are final, so give the preview a quick look before you say yes.
